Kelvaran Industries delivered the revised term sheet Friday. Key points: pre-money unchanged, liquidation preference reduced to 1x, anti-dilution now broad-based. Exclusivity period is 45 days — tight but workable. Outstanding items: IP warranties, escrow percentage, and the tooling transfer at the Dunmere site. Finance to model both earn-out scenarios by Wednesday. Legal review closes Friday. No external discussion until signing. Decision call is Monday. The confidential note on dependent business plans follows directly below.

board note of yadup-fajef: Druiusox Holdings is in early talks to buy Norwynek Systems for about $186.0 million. The Kaseth launch date is June 24, and nothing goes to the press before then. Legal wants the Quenethek Group term sheet withdrawn before November 27.

All producers on the Marrowgate platform register Avro schemas with Larkspool before publishing; compatibility mode is backward-transitive, so removing required fields will be rejected. Watch the nightly compaction job — if it stalls, consumers see lookup latency spikes within an hour. New team members should read the subject-naming convention doc before registering anything. The registry itself is stateless apart from its backing store, and it boots from the configuration values below.

deployment values, yahag-tawef:
ZORWYN_HOST=zorwyn.tolvaqlabs.internal
ZORWYN_PORT=9300

Postmortem reference: the stale-cache incident in the Corvane lookup service stemmed from the /v1/cache/invalidate endpoint silently dropping requests when the payload exceeded 1 MB. Clients received 202 despite no invalidation occurring, leaving entries stale for up to 14 hours. The fix adds a 413 response and a size check in the client SDK. To reproduce or verify invalidation behavior in staging, call the endpoint with the diagnostics service key, which is required on every request and is provided below.

API key for yahig-tadup: kto7_ubizbYm